# Basement Archive Room — Night Access

The archive room under Pellworth House holds old contracts and the tape backups. Night shift: take stairwell C, not the lift (it's switched off after midnight). Lights are on a timer by the door — slap the button as you go in. Sign the logbook, even at 3am, yes really. The keypad by the door takes the code below.

staff pass of fahap-tajeg = bdg-FT-6

Several external plugin authors report that the Tallystone loyalty-points ledger rejects their sync payloads with SIGNATURE_MISMATCH since the v9 gateway update. Root cause: the verification endpoint now expects payloads signed against the rotated plugin-publishing key, not the legacy one bundled in the old SDK samples. Action for plugin authors: rebuild and re-sign your plugin manifests, then resubmit through the validation portal. For all new submissions, sign using the current key, reproduced below.

release key, hadug-kawef: bky13_mPGeFZeR1GZ1G

**Step 4: Pin the toolchain inputs**

Before moving the Quillbase services onto the Hermeton build system, every external input must be declared explicitly; implicit host dependencies will fail the sandbox. Remove any reliance on system compilers and point the build at the vendored toolchain bundle prepared by the Deckard team. Reviewers should verify that no network fetches remain in the build graph. The pinned configuration the migration expects is reproduced below for comparison.

service settings:
wenix:
  pin: 0857
  metrics_host: metrics.wenix.lumiclabs.internal
  tenant: ulavan
  seal: seal_db298014